"No one takes my life from me..."
In the first century, Christians sang a hymn in honor of the voluntary sacrifice of Jesus. Paul quoted the hymn in his letter to the Philippians:

Have this attitude in yourselves
which was also in Christ Jesus,
who,
although He existed in the form of God,
did not regard equality with God a thing to be grasped,
but emptied Himself,
taking the form of a bond-servant,
and being made in the likeness of men.

And being found in appearance as a man,

He humbled Himself
by becoming obedient
to the point of death,
even death on a cross.


These haunting lyrics confirmed Jesus' own previous testimony, offered shortly before his death:

No one takes my life from me,
but I lay it down of my own initiative.


Jesus was a not a victim of circumstance; he powerfully and consciously chose both to live and to die. The disciple of Jesus can reflect his Lord's attitude in what might show up as adversity:

No one takes my life from me,

but I lay it down of my own initiative.

When a man chooses to "lay down his life of his own initiative," he powerfully and consciously chooses to act--not from a place of fear and compulsion, but from a place of power, of love, and of a sound mind. It may appear, on occassion, that decisions have been made for us, that we have been caught up in the rush of the inevitable and the insufferable. But like Jesus, we can choose not to become a victim of circumstance. We can own even that which we can neither change nor control:

No one takes my life from me,
but I lay it down of my own initiative.


Where do you see yourself as a hapless victim?
How does it show up in you?

What's the lie?

How might you convert the inevitable and the insufferable
into the voluntary?

How might this shift in perspective show up in you?
In your spirit and energy? In your relationships?
In your vocation or avocation?


Scripture references: Philippians 2:5-8; John 10:18; 2 Timothy 4:7.
